Micromobility on the agenda

Intelligent Transport Systems New Zealand (ITSNZ) is hosting a free informative event on micromobility in Auckland. 

Aiming to inform, inspire and connect attendees, the event will discuss the future of micromobility, urban transport and put questions to a panel of mobility experts. 

In recent months, the rapid influx of e-scooters, e-bikes, hoverboards and other types of micromobility has had huge impacts on major cities around the world. 

The rapid adoption brought on by fleets and increasing private ownership means decision-makers are under pressure to react quickly to understand the implications for public safety, regulation and infrastructure to achieve the full potential of benefits and mitigate problems.

The event will discuss why new mobility options are expected to be a major disruptor. Speakers will examine how New Zealand is responding and look at international examples, discussing behaviour change, sustainability, safety and impacts on design for infrastructure, cities and the people who live there.
